Klingon word: peD Part of speech: verb Definition: snow, fall slowly (like snow) Source: TKD, qepHom 2017 _______________________________________________
peDtaH 'ej chIS qo' (Dutch magazine "Oor", Nov-Dec 2011, p.39: "Fifty Words for Snow" by Kate Bush)
[Someone refresh my memory: Was this example supplied by Okrand?]
For ages I thought it was just some random unknown Klingonist, but apparently it was Okrand after all! [Update, 11/24: Marc Okrand confirms via email that he indeed is the source
of the Klingon line. He explains that *peDtaH 'ej chIS qo'* means "It's snowing and the world is white." Okrand is thanked in the liner notes (with the Klingon expression of gratitude, *qatlho'*).]
